在我的MVC应用程序中,我正在从数据库动态生成Radiobuttonlist。有15条记录,但我想只显示其中的前5条。是否可以使用RadiobuttonlistFor或任何其他方式执行此操作?
感谢。
答案 0 :(得分:1)
无论您在哪里生成或使用包含单选按钮列表项列表的集合,您都可以使用LINQ $this->Appartements->find()
->join([
'i' => [
'table' => 'Immeubles',
'type' => 'inner',
'conditions' => [
'i.id=Appartements.immeuble_id',
'i.complex_id' => 4
]]]);
方法仅获取5。
Take
假设yourRadioButtonList的类型为yourRadioButtonList = yourRadioButtonList.Take(5);